Paul Klee (1879-1940)

Fruchtbares geregelt

signed lower left 'Klee'--titled, dated and numbered
on the mount 'Fruchtbares geregelt 1933 L.8.'--watercolor on paper suspended in the artist's mount
Image size: 7¾ x 10¼in. (19.8 x 26cm.)
Mount size (sight): 10½ x 10 5/8in. (26.6 x 27cm.)
Provenance
Lily Klee, Bern (1940-1946)
Klee-Gesellschaft, Bern (1946-1950)
Buchholz Gallery (Curt Valentin), New York (acquired by the late owner, 1950)
Literature
Oeuvre-Katalog Klee, 1933, no. 28 (L.8)
Exhibited
Liège, Association pour le progrès intellectual et artisque de la Wallonie, Paul Klee, Peintures et dessins, April, 1949, no. 24 (titled Mesures fertiles)

Lot Essay

This watercolor was painted on the reverse of an uncompleted and cut down composition which is visible through the mount.

Josef Helfenstein and Stefan Frey of the Paul Klee-Stiftung have confirmed the authenticity of this watercolor.
